Credentials Committee Theology Class Postponed

The CCCC Systematic Theology Class sponsored by the Credentials committee for pastors and lay leaders has been postponed due to the coronavirus pandemic. Work is being done to reschedule for Fall, likely in October. Please watch for more details.
